Gettysburg One-Hour Walking Tour: Danger & Courage

Overview
Baltimore Street and Steinwehr Avenue were trapped in the crossfire between Union and Confederate troops. On this tour you will hear about the tragic death of Jennie Wade, how civilians survived the battle, the fighting between the two sides in the streets, the aftermath of the battle, presidential visits, and some of Gettysburg’s early history.

Walk the streets of Gettysburg with an experienced licensed town guide. Group sizes are generally under ten for these tours.

This tour complements the 11:00 a.m. tour (Civilian Experience). This tour covers the Southern End of town; the Civilian Experience covers the Northern End.
